summaryrefslogtreecommitdiffstats
path: root/libmpdemux/stheader.h
diff options
context:
space:
mode:
authorarpi <arpi@b3059339-0415-0410-9bf9-f77b7e298cf2>2002-10-05 22:55:45 +0000
committerarpi <arpi@b3059339-0415-0410-9bf9-f77b7e298cf2>2002-10-05 22:55:45 +0000
commit3053a8b7f248363d7f47c5718e1b292b7f974960 (patch)
treeda0af1c1ba6b9dc2872aa7aa85f4d5ad88b10f6e /libmpdemux/stheader.h
parent18e342e06c5e756bfa8e2de056ab716bd590a5a9 (diff)
downloadmpv-3053a8b7f248363d7f47c5718e1b292b7f974960.tar.bz2
mpv-3053a8b7f248363d7f47c5718e1b292b7f974960.tar.xz
aufio filter layer (libaf) integration to libmpcodecs, mplayer and mencoder
git-svn-id: svn://svn.mplayerhq.hu/mplayer/trunk@7605 b3059339-0415-0410-9bf9-f77b7e298cf2
Diffstat (limited to 'libmpdemux/stheader.h')
-rw-r--r--libmpdemux/stheader.h12
1 files changed, 9 insertions, 3 deletions
diff --git a/libmpdemux/stheader.h b/libmpdemux/stheader.h
index 559af7d67f..12dff42c10 100644
--- a/libmpdemux/stheader.h
+++ b/libmpdemux/stheader.h
@@ -55,15 +55,21 @@ typedef struct {
int o_bps; // == samplerate*samplesize*channels (uncompr. bytes/sec)
int i_bps; // == bitrate (compressed bytes/sec)
// in buffers:
- int audio_in_minsize;
+ int audio_in_minsize; // max. compressed packet size (== min. in buffer size)
char* a_in_buffer;
int a_in_buffer_len;
int a_in_buffer_size;
- // out buffers:
- int audio_out_minsize;
+ // decoder buffers:
+ int audio_out_minsize; // max. uncompressed packet size (==min. out buffsize)
char* a_buffer;
int a_buffer_len;
int a_buffer_size;
+ // output buffers:
+ char* a_out_buffer;
+ int a_out_buffer_len;
+ int a_out_buffer_size;
+// void* audio_out; // the audio_out handle, used for this audio stream
+ void* afilter; // the audio filter stream
// win32-compatible codec parameters:
AVIStreamHeader audio;
WAVEFORMATEX* wf;